Industrial Equipment Specialist

3 weeks ago


Town Of Port Hedland, Australia beBeeMaintenance Full time $75,000 - $89,000
Job Description

Maintenance technicians play a pivotal role in ensuring the smooth operation of industrial facilities by performing routine maintenance tasks, repairing equipment, and implementing preventative measures to minimize downtime.

The ideal candidate will have trade qualifications as a Fitter and/or Boilermaker with experience in Conveyors, Motors, and Gearboxes. Forklift Tickets are an added advantage, but willingness to train is essential.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Perform major and minor repairs of fixed and mobile plant and equipment
  • Assist with plant and equipment breakdowns
  • Conduct minor welding on plant and equipment
  • Participate in preventative and predictive maintenance programs for all plant and equipment
  • Work in accordance with a daily plan for routine maintenance and complete relevant maintenance records
  • Contribute to continuous improvement and other programs as required
Requirements:
  • Trade qualifications as a Fitter and/or Boilermaker with experience in Conveyors, Motors, and Gearboxes
  • Forklift Tickets an added advantage, but willing to train
  • Ability & willingness to pass a medical in line with the requirements of the role
  • Experience in a similar position within a similar industry
  • Good communication skills and the ability to work autonomously or in a team environment
